Computer Science (COSC)

COSC 1557  Introduction to Computer Science View Details
COSC 1567  Programming in C++ View Details
COSC 1666  Engineering Graphics View Details
COSC 1757  Digital Systems View Details
COSC 1901  New Media Tools View Details
COSC 1902  Coding Techniques View Details
COSC 2006  Data Structures I View Details
COSC 2007  Data Structures II View Details
COSC 2106  Machine Structures I View Details
COSC 2107  Machine Structures II View Details
COSC 2116  Artificial Neural Network Computing View Details
COSC 2206  Mathematical Computation View Details
COSC 2216  Introduction to Computational Geometry View Details
COSC 2406  Introduction to Game Design and Development View Details
COSC 2667  Operating Systems I View Details
COSC 2767  Object-Oriented Programming View Details
COSC 3006  Numerical Methods I View Details
COSC 3007  Artificial Intelligence View Details
COSC 3017  Introduction to Robotics View Details
COSC 3206  Theory of Computation View Details
COSC 3207  Computer Graphics View Details
COSC 3306  Programming Paradigms View Details
COSC 3307  3D Computer Graphics View Details
COSC 3406  Advanced Game Design and Development View Details
COSC 3407  Systems Control View Details
COSC 3606  Databases & Data Management View Details
COSC 3657  Distributed Systems View Details
COSC 3706  The Computing Profession View Details
COSC 3806  Service Computing View Details
COSC 3807  Project Management View Details
COSC 3997  Senior Practicum View Details
COSC 4106  Human Computer Interaction View Details
COSC 4127  Real-time Programming View Details
COSC 4206  Topics in Computing Science View Details
COSC 4207  Seminars in Computer Science View Details
COSC 4406  Software Engineering View Details
COSC 4607  Security and Protection View Details
COSC 4896  Honours Research I View Details
COSC 4897  Honours Research II View Details
COSC 4997  Honours Practicum View Details
Nipissing University
100 College Drive, Box 5002, North Bay, ON, Canada  P1B 8L7  Tel: 705.474.3450 | Fax: 705.474.1947 | TTY: 877.688.5507
nuinfo@nipissingu.ca

© Nipissing University 2015DisclaimerPrivacyAccessibility